People maybe didnt know it at the time, but Genie Francis who played Laura, had been on the show for 2+ years..as a relatively minor cast member, she was the teenage daughter of Dr Leslie Weber ..a main character on the show+ and she really didn't appear often or have s storyline..until..the shows creator and head writer, Gloria Monty decided to rejuvenate the lackluster soap, which was not doing well with the ratings, so much so it was close to being cancelled. Her idea was to attract a new, young audience - with characters and stories that would intrigue young adult viewers. So she started by having a meeting with Frances and her parents to inform them her role was about to be greatly expanded - meaning maximum working hours for the then still only 14 yr old - and she eas ready for the opportunity. So the before mentioned barely seen character of Laura stepped out of the shadows when her character ran away from home and IT became the new focus. Anyone remember that? I do, because thst story of a troubled, moody teenage girl, distraught with her parents marriage problems and her own insecurity really resonated. Laura became a polarizing character on her own - tnan Monty handpicked Anthony Geary to play Luke...and the show just exploded. Its true, "Luke" was initially written to be a bad guy for a limited time. Meaning he'd probably die or just leave Port Charles forever ...but the chemistry of Luke and Laura drew record breaking audiences..so show writers changed the role inro a very long story of love and redemption.
